Location and Company Background
Situated approximately 60 kilometers from Lydenburg and 40 kilometers from Burgersfort, Dwarsrivier Chrome Mine is strategically located to facilitate its operations in the mining industry. Key Responsibilities
The Blasting Assistant will be tasked with a range of duties aimed at ensuring safe and effective blasting operations:
- Face Preparation: Involvement in the preparation of the mining face before drilling operations commence.
- Explosive Handling: Responsible for the preparation and transportation of explosives to the designated areas, ensuring compliance with safety protocols.
- Charging Rounds: Assist in the charging up of the round prior to blasting, adhering to stringent safety measures.
- Work Area Safety: Maintain a clean and organized work area, ensuring that all safety protocols are followed.
- Post-Blasting Procedures: Conduct preliminary examinations after blasting, including watering down the area, inspecting the face, and cleaning sockets.
- Geological Feature Marking: Accurately demarcate geological features as part of the operational process.
- Misfire Treatment: Under supervision, handle any misfires according to established safety procedures.
- Measurements and Direction Lines: Assist with taking measurements and establishing direction lines for subsequent operations.
- Explosive Orders: Receive and manage explosives orders, including handovers at the magazine and ensuring proper transportation to the work section.
- Blast Timing and Connections: Provide timing assistance and support during the connection of blasts.
- Personal Protective Equipment (PPE): Use and maintain personal protective equipment as required by mining regulations.
